I still owe you an explanation about “what represents a biggest problem for me updating this site, while being on the road”. I started the…
Author: James Dean
James is the manager of moillusions.com. He spends his time finding the most popular optical illusions so that YOU keep coming back to your site for more! Check him out on https://plus.google.com/u/1/109932087769818686311/